German power-to-gas facility opens green methanation plant; €28M STORE&GO project

Green Car Congress

While the current facility feeds pure hydrogen (“WindGas”) directly into the gas grid, the new methanation plant provides for the generation of “green” methane. In this second stage, hydrogen from regenerative energy sources is converted into methane (CH 4 ), i.e. synthetic natural gas, using CO 2 from a bio-ethanol plant.

BMW i home energy storage system integrates 2nd-life i3 vehicle batteries

Green Car Congress

Utilizing real-time energy readings, the system can measure the available energy supply and demand, making the necessary calculations to determine the optimal time to charge or discharge the system. This approach minimizes energy waste, effectively reducing energy costs on a day-to-day basis. BMW i 360° Electric.
